Rare Familygoboston Posted July 26, 2013 #7 Share Posted July 26, 2013 If its listed and "bookable" you can book it. For something like cabanas, which go fast- it's well worth doing! Some caveats for NOT doing it for other early listed excursions... 1.they can and do change excursions and you might find yours cancelled at some point along the way (this is unlikely for the "cabana excursion" or any private island excursion (zip line, coaster etc) as that is owned and operated by the cruise line and so they have complete control over it, but other operators may change prices, go out of business etc) You will get you $ back, so it's not big deal if it changes 2.its too early to see all the whole menu of excursions, so if you aren't sure what you'd like to do; booking an excursion this early means you probably can't see all the eventual offerings and you might select something prematurely and prefer another one. Of course, again, it's easily changed! In the case of the OP for cabanas; if you want one- grab it now, they are popular!:D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Snooksi Posted July 26, 2013 #10 Share Posted July 26, 2013 can someone show me a picture of one and how much do they usually cost. where on the website can you rent them? On the RCI website. Log into your reservation and they are under daily planner/excursions. Just look up cabana or Labadee and there are TONS of pictures and discussions on the excursion thread. Over the Water are $250 and the Beach and Hilltops Cabanas are $225. It seems the over the water ones are the most popular. http://cruiseforums.cruisecritic.com/forumdisplay.php?f=406 Good luck!
